Description
With Kang Dol's crush on Yang Yang growing larger and larger, he decides to confess his feelings. With his back turned against her, he makes a courageous confession. But when he opens his eyes and turns around, instead of Yang Yang, he finds Min Dosim standing in front of him. Oops?! But the more shocking twist is that Dosim, the school's most popular girl, mistakenly obliges and they decide to go out! What is Kang Dol supposed to do to fix this mess?

Surprised at the negative/lukewarm comments. I found this series to be enjoyable!

It was so refreshing to see the character growth for Kang Dol. It's not every day that we get a weak main character, and it's not like he became somehow really cool at the end either. Tbh, his pushover personality was a bit unbearable at first, but throughout the story you get to see there's more to that pushover-ness (and plus he does grow a bit too). The other 3 characters all get a bit of back story to them so they are all fleshed out too.

The story is unpredictable (in a good way) because the characters act so differently (IN A GOOD WAY!). The plot doesn't get dragged out and it is a happy ending too. Lots of comedy sprinkled throughout but there are times it makes you think deeply too.

Also, my thoughts... sure the main character is male, but everything else tells me this is aimed towards a female audience. And also, I really liked this webtoon, but I couldn't finish Mango's Bone (not sure what it was that I didn't like about it). Everyone's got their own opinion!

I haven't read a romance manga/manhwa like this for a while. Most manga/manhwa nowadays tend to be more expressive and direct than it is about the underline emotions and understanding of the characters. But with all said and done, there really isn't anything different from Doridosim compare to most Shounen Romance out there. It has your typical male lead and the popular female lead that is attracted to his kindness. A guy manga/manhwa for sure.

However, there is one element that makes this better than the others. It doesn't beat around the bush and it doesn't drag the story. Unlike other manga where the misunderstanding is drag on until the very end, this one is quick to clear everything out. It lead us into a unique space where the story is actually progressing rather than being at a stand still with the misunderstanding. This puts more pressure on the author to generate new ideas and make the story interesting which shows that the author is actually creative and not just relying on the misunderstanding to run the story.
